Gabion mesh refers to wire mesh baskets filled with stones, soil, or other materials used for a variety of structural purposes. These baskets, often made from steel wire or coated with protective materials, serve multiple functions, including erosion control, slope stabilization, and as noise barriers. 3. Repurposing for Home Construction Chicken wire has also found a place in smaller construction projects. It can be used as reinforcement in plastering and as a backing for stucco applications. Additionally, in regions prone to earthquakes, chicken wire can be embedded in concrete to reinforce walls, providing added stability.

2x2 welded wire refers to a type of wire mesh that consists of horizontal and vertical wires that are welded together at every intersection, creating a grid pattern with two-inch spaces between the wires. Typically made from steel, the wire is galvanized to enhance its resistance to rust and corrosion, making it su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ications.

Beyond its agricultural applications, barbed wire has become an enduring symbol of division. During World War I, it was extensively used in trench warfare to protect soldiers from enemy advances, creating a stark line of demarcation between opposing forces. The imagery of barbed wire evokes feelings of entrapment and danger, capturing the harrowing experiences of soldiers and the brutality of war.

Razor sharp barbed wire is comprised of wire strands that are intertwined with sharp metal blades, usually manufactured from galvanized steel. The blades are designed to cut and puncture, providing an additional layer of security compared to traditional barbed wire. The spacing and sharpness of the blades create a formidable obstacle for anyone attempting to climb over or cut through the barrier. Whether used in straight lines or twisted into coils, razor wire presents a formidable challenge for potential intruders.

One of the most common uses of metal barbed wire is in agricultural settings, where it serves to contain livestock and protect crops. Farmers utilize barbed wire to construct fences around their fields and pastures, deterring animals from escaping and preventing wildlife from intruding. The threat of injury caused by the sharp barbs also acts as a psychological barrier for animals, making them think twice before approaching.
